Introduction:

Diabetes insipidus is a condition that impairs the capacity of the kidneys to retain water, resulting in thirst and urination. Diabetes insipidus, as opposed to diabetes mellitus, distinguished by high blood sugar levels, is caused by a lack of antidiuretic hormone (ADH) or a failure of the kidneys to respond to ADH. ADH regulates the quantity of water reabsorbed by the kidneys, preserving the body's fluid equilibrium.

How to Balance Fluid in the Body?

Fluid balance is required for the body to function properly. It is essential for blood pressure control, body temperature regulation, nutrient and waste products, and optimal cellular activity. Fluid balance is achieved by the body's complex fluid intake and output interactions.

When the body is in a state of fluid equilibrium, the amount of water entering it from various sources, such as food and drink, equals the amount of water leaving it through sweating, urine, breathing, and other biological functions. However, in those with diabetes insipidus, this delicate balance is broken, resulting in excess fluid loss.

What Are the Causes and Symptoms of Diabetes Insipidus?

The symptoms of diabetes insipidus differ based on the underlying cause and severity. The most common symptoms are extreme thirst (polydipsia) and increased urine (polyuria). Individuals with diabetes insipidus may drink excessive amounts of water and urinate frequently, especially at night.

Diabetes insipidus has two basic causes: central diabetes insipidus and nephrogenic diabetes insipidus. Central diabetes insipidus develops when there is a lack of ADH due to injury or malfunctioning in the hypothalamus or pituitary gland. In contrast, nephrogenic diabetes insipidus develops when the kidneys cannot respond to ADH, even when it exists in appropriate amounts.

What Is the Importance of Fluid Replacement in Diabetes Insipidus?

Fluid replacement is essential in managing diabetes insipidus because it prevents dehydration and maintains the body's fluid balance. Individuals with diabetes insipidus have a higher risk of fluid loss; thus, it is critical to restore the lost fluids adequately.

Failure to do so can result in electrolyte imbalances, renal malfunction, and potentially fatal dehydration. The major purpose of fluid replacement in diabetes insipidus is to ensure the body has enough fluids to fulfill its requirements. This can be accomplished through various techniques, including increasing oral fluid consumption, utilizing drugs to boost ADH production or improve the kidneys' reaction to ADH, and using intravenous fluids in severe situations.

What Are the Types of Fluid Replacement Options?

Individuals with diabetes insipidus can use a variety of fluid replacement strategies. The fluid replacement type varies depending on the condition's extent, personal preferences, and the fundamental cause of diabetes insipidus.

The primary types of fluid replacement options are:

  • Oral Rehydration: Oral rehydration is the most commonly used and preferred technique of fluid replacement for people with mild to moderate diabetic insipidus. It entails boosting fluid intake by consuming water, juices, herbal teas, and other non-alcoholic liquids. To stay hydrated, spread out the fluid intake throughout the day.

  • Medications: In some circumstances, drugs may be recommended to increase ADH production or improve the kidneys' reaction to ADH. These drugs can help reduce thirst and urination while improving fluid balance. It is critical to adhere to the recommended dosage and consult a healthcare practitioner for ideal management.

  • Intravenous Fluid Administration: In extreme situations of diabetes insipidus, where oral rehydration and medicines fail, intravenous fluid administration may be required. This includes injecting fluids into the bloodstream via a vein, resulting in quick hydration and electrolyte equilibrium restoration.

What Is the Importance of Monitoring Fluid Intake and Output?

Monitoring fluid intake and output is critical for controlling diabetic insipidus. Maintaining track of the amount of fluid ingested and the frequency and volume of urination can assist in assessing whether fluid replacement is appropriate or whether adjustments are required. It is recommended that individuals keep a fluid intake and output rate to track these measures properly.

Monitoring can be accomplished by measuring the amount of fluid consumed with measuring cups or bottles and noting it in a book. Similarly, recording the volume of each urine sample with a measuring cup can provide useful information. Regular monitoring and discussion with a healthcare practitioner can assist in guaranteeing enough fluid replacement and avoiding issues.

What Are the Tips for Maintaining Hydration in Diabetes Insipidus?

Individuals with diabetes insipidus should carry a water bottle throughout the day to avoid dehydration and excessive thirst. Set reminders on the mobile device or utilize apps to monitor water consumption. Incorporate hydrating items such as fruits, vegetables, and soups into the diet to help with fluid consumption. Caffeine and alcohol can have diuretic effects and increase urine production, so limit consumption. Choose water or non-diuretic choices instead. Be careful of physical activity, as increased fluid loss through sweating can increase thirst. Take fluids before, during, and following physical activity to remain hydrated.

What Are the Diet Recommendations for Managing Diabetes Insipidus?

A nutritious diet is essential for people with diabetes insipidus to preserve their general health and fluid balance. Consume water-rich fruits and vegetables such as watermelon, cucumbers, tomatoes, and oranges to accomplish this.

Limit the salt intake by minimizing processed and packaged foods and instead eating fresh, natural foods. Consume enough protein from lean sources such as poultry, fish, tofu, and legumes for repairing tissues and immunological function.

Consult a qualified dietitian for specialized nutritional suggestions. Specialists can assess specific needs and develop a balanced food plan suited to the circumstances.
